First, you need to have terminal access to your ECwith either one of the method listed in AWS manual: . How to upload large and multiple files on aws susing. The AWS SDK for PHP supports uploading large files to Amazon Sby. To proper upload big files you should use PHP streams.
The largest single file that can be uploaded into an Amazon SBucket in a single PUT operation is GB.
We upload large images by part using this API. Multi part API divides large object . GB something ) directly to s. I think this is the way to go for. With PHP , any standard file upload must remain under the.
Swithout ever seeing a spike in your . As pointed out in the comments, this ended up being a PHP config issue.
While I had set the post_max_size and memory_limit arguments to . There are various third party commercial tools that claims to help people upload large files to Amazon Sand Amazon also provides a Multipart . Implementing this with the help of the aws -sdk- php package . This has many advantages, especially on cloud platforms where uploading a large file would cause unnecessary performance issues. I will focus on the usage of AWS Simple Storage Service ( S) and will wrap up with a. To support large file uploads we will create a bucket. So if you want to upload large files consider the stream approach. The 30GB CSV payload was split into ~3files, so we started playing with concatenating the files into a single large file and uploading it using . S-writeObject() uses.
Amazon recommends to consider multi part uploads for all files . PHP has limits on the size of items that can be uploaded , as well as the amount of time it will hold a connection open. Videos and other files can . How do you upload large files without latency, spee timeouts and interruptions? Check out these guides on how to handle a PHP file upload , jQuery . Laravel Suploads failing when uploading large files in Laravel 5.
However, performing a resumable upload with services like Sas the . PHP will only require a few MB of RAM even if you upload a file of several GB. You can also use streams to download a file from Sto the local . MySQL, the filesystem, or a cloud storage service like Amazon S). To upload large files , you need to increase all the limits to at least 32MB. You can upload large files to Amazon Sin multiple parts. Then register the bundles in AppKernel.
First step in our workflow is to upload a file from Symfony to AWS. PHP configuration files to get a file to upload , you know that uploading large files can be a real pain. File uploads are one of the vital pieces in most web projects, and Laravel. I'm trying to upload a audio file, and it works perfectly with smaller.
Well, practically speaking, your server has a finite amount of resources available to it, and these uploads will compete for resources with the . See, I have an Amazon Saccount, and have it integrated with Pydio. Upload large files to sjava. Did you try to tweak your php to support large files upload with the .
Ingen kommentarer:
Send en kommentar
Bemærk! Kun medlemmer af denne blog kan sende kommentarer.